The lyrics to Foster the People's "Best Friend" are a testament to the loyalty and unconditional love one has for their closest friends. The singer is speaking of a time when their best friend has hit rock bottom and succumbed to addiction. Despite the hardships they face and the pain they feel, the singer vows to never let their friend fall alone. They promise to do everything in their power to lift their friend up and stand by them throughout their struggle. The phrase "when your best friends are strung out, you'll do everything you can" is the central theme of the song.
The song is a mix of pain, hope, and love. The idea of addiction is presented as waves that come and go, and while it is difficult to face, it is hardest at the beginning. The singer reminisces about the moments they shared with their friend before things got bad and wishes to see those times again. The lyrics "sometimes it feels like I only dream in black and white, but colors so" hints at how the singer feels like they are in a dark place but still have hope for a better future.
The chorus is a powerful repetition of the sentiment that no matter where their friend is, and no matter how much they may struggle or change, their friendship will remain steadfast. The song is a message about never giving up on the people we love, no matter what.
